Godzilla Vs Cthulhu Poster
Jan. 12, 2025
Godzilla Versus Cthulhu 7" x 10.5" Art Print cthulhu vs godzilla | Kaiju art, Godzilla, Godzilla vs Godzilla Vs Cthulhu" Poster for Sale by ChaoticStories | Redbubble ArtStation - Godzilla vs. Cthulhu poster | Godzilla Vs Cthulhu Poster